Mrs. Binita Thakur, a 1996 batch IPS officer from the Rajasthan cadre, has been appointed as Additional Director General (ADG) in the Central Industrial Security Force (CISF) on deputation. Her appointment places her in a crucial role overseeing security for India’s industrial installations, airports, and other sensitive zones managed by CISF.
